Or you could code a job to so SDSF lookup (fairly simple really) in the CICS 
region JESMSGLG for the DFHSI1517 message.

Tony,

INQUIRE SYSTEM CICSSTATUS(CVDA)  should give you that.

so when you try that over an EXCI connection you should be fine.

If CICS does not answer within five seconds you could ask the operator for 
assistance (or whatever).
